We are trying to figure out if we can provision a NEW user ID into LDAP (AD) through CUP? Ideally we will have a Manager enter a request into CUP that includes a user's SAP access as well as AD and have CUP autoprovision this access.
In reading the guides it seems CUP can only write groups to existing AD users.

CUP can provision existing LDAP groups to existing IDs, but as you said, cannot create new ones. The best method to incorporate this would be to connect CUP to an IDM system to provision the ID and access. If this is not acceptable, the other option is to create a custom connector that would communicate with a third party application (such as a macro/script) that would create the IDs through a separate process.
